Court orders her to settle bills
A young woman who used a friend’s credit card to pay traffic fines worth Dh69,000 in Abu Dhabi has been ordered to repay the man.
The order was issued by the Abu Dhabi Court of Family and Civil and Administrative Claims after the Arab woman refused to make any payments. She claimed the man wanted to help her and allowed her to use the card as a “gift”.
However, court records show that the Arab man filed a lawsuit against her, demanding that she return her credit card and settle the Dh69,369 bill.
The man told the court that while he confirmed it was he who handed her the card, the woman should have loaded it so she could use it to do some online shopping.
The woman reportedly used her credit card to pay the traffic fine. The plaintiff said she never deposited any money for the card.
During the trial, the woman admitted to using her credit card to pay the traffic fine, but insisted it was a gift and no payment agreement was reached.
However, the court rejected her claim. In addition to paying the man, the woman was ordered to bear the plaintiff’s legal costs.
